Mae Lea Designs

Business Description

Mae Lea Designs is a BBB accredited graphic design company that has won several awards including’s Top Business of the Year. 3 years consecutively.


Email: [email protected]

Phone number: 704-781-8827

Address: PO Box 202 - Indian Trail, NC 28079

Category: Professional Services

Operation hours: None

( ratings)

Reviews from

  • Image

  • Image

  • Image

Reviews from Bossing Up

  • No reviews here yet :(
    Be the first to review on the form below.

Leave a review